What Is a 36V LiFePO4 Battery and Why Is It Ideal for Trolling Motors?

A 36V LiFePO4 battery is a lithium iron phosphate battery with a nominal voltage of 36 volts. It is known for its safety, stability, and long cycle life, making it ideal for applications like trolling motors.

According to the Battery University, LiFePO4 batteries are recognized for their high thermal stability and low toxicity, contributing to their popularity in various energy applications. They provide a reliable energy source with a long lifespan, often exceeding 2,000 charge cycles.

These batteries feature a stable chemistry that offers many benefits. They provide a consistent voltage output, have a high discharge rate, and exhibit minimal capacity loss over time. They are lighter compared to lead-acid batteries, thus enhancing maneuverability in watercraft.

The U.S. Department of Energy describes LiFePO4 batteries as having a high energy density, which results in longer usage times for devices like trolling motors. They also possess a greater tolerance to temperature extremes, further enhancing their reliability in outdoor conditions.

Several factors contribute to the preference for LiFePO4 batteries. Their non-toxic chemistry and safety profile reduce environmental risks. Additionally, they offer a higher charge retention compared to traditional batteries.

What Are the Key Advantages of Using a 36V LiFePO4 Battery in Marine Environments?

The key advantages of using a 36V LiFePO4 battery in marine environments include improved safety, longer lifespan, higher energy density, and reduced maintenance.

  6. Safety:
    Using a 36V LiFePO4 battery enhances safety due to its chemically stable composition. LiFePO4, or Lithium Iron Phosphate, is less likely to overheat compared to other lithium batteries. It is less prone to combustion or explosion, making it suitable for marine applications where safety is paramount. A study by the Department of Energy (2019) emphasized that LiFePO4 batteries have a thermal stability that significantly reduces fire risk.

  7. Longevity:
    The longevity of a 36V LiFePO4 battery is one of its standout features. These batteries can last up to 2000-5000 charge cycles. This lifespan far exceeds that of traditional lead-acid batteries, which typically last 500-1000 cycles. According to a battery industry report by Battery University (2020), the long life of LiFePO4 batteries translates to cost savings over time, reducing the need for frequent replacements in marine equipment.

  8. Energy Density:
    A 36V LiFePO4 battery offers higher energy density compared to lead-acid batteries. Energy density refers to the amount of energy stored in a given volume. LiFePO4 batteries provide a weight advantage, allowing for more power without increasing vessel weight. The Marine Battery Report (2021) noted that this energy efficiency is crucial in applications requiring lightweight solutions, such as electric propulsion in boats.

  9. Maintenance:
    A 36V LiFePO4 battery requires minimal maintenance. Unlike traditional batteries, they do not need regular watering or equalization charges. This low-maintenance requirement is particularly beneficial in marine environments where accessibility may be limited. A 2022 survey by Boating Magazine highlighted that boat owners appreciate the reduced maintenance needs, allowing them more time to enjoy their vessels.

  10. Temperature Tolerance:
    LiFePO4 batteries exhibit superior temperature tolerance. They can operate efficiently in a wide range of temperatures, making them suitable for varied marine conditions. The National Renewable Energy Laboratory (2020) reported that LiFePO4 batteries maintain performance across temperatures from -20°C to 60°C, keeping vessels operational in diverse climates and reducing reliance on climate-controlled storage.

Overall, these advantages make 36V LiFePO4 batteries a compelling choice for marine applications, from electric propulsion systems to powering onboard electronics.

What Features Should You Look for in the Best 36V LiFePO4 Battery for Trolling Motors?

To find the best 36V LiFePO4 battery for trolling motors, consider several key features that enhance performance and longevity.

When evaluating these features, it is important to understand how each contributes to the performance and usability of the battery.

  1. Battery Capacity (Ah):
    The battery capacity, measured in ampere-hours (Ah), indicates how much energy the battery can store. A higher capacity allows for longer usage times on the water. For example, a 100 Ah battery can sustain a trolling motor for a longer period than a 50 Ah battery under similar conditions, making it crucial for extended fishing trips or longer excursions.

  2. Cycle Life:
    Cycle life represents the number of complete charge-discharge cycles a battery can undergo before its capacity significantly declines. LiFePO4 batteries typically offer 2000 to 5000 cycles. This feature ensures the battery remains reliable over many uses. For instance, a battery with a 3000 cycle life may last up to ten years with proper care, providing better value over time.

  3. Weight and Size:
    Weight and size affect the battery’s ease of installation and handling. A lightweight battery can enhance boat performance. For example, a 36V LiFePO4 battery weighing around 30-50 pounds is easier to manage compared to heavier alternatives. It also provides better weight distribution on small boats.

  4. Depth of Discharge (DoD):
    DoD indicates how much of the battery’s capacity can be used without damaging its lifespan. Many LiFePO4 batteries support a DoD of up to 80-100%. This means you can use more of the battery’s power without harming future performance, which is crucial for users who rely heavily on their trolling motors.

  5. Built-in Battery Management System (BMS):
    A built-in BMS enhances battery safety by protecting against overcharging, overheating, and short circuits. This system actively monitors the battery’s health. Batteries equipped with a robust BMS can prevent damage and maximize efficiency, ensuring longevity and safety while operating.

  6. Charging Time:
    Charging time varies between batteries. A good LiFePO4 battery should charge quickly, often within a few hours. Fast charging capabilities mean less downtime and more time on the water, which is particularly beneficial for avid anglers who may need quick recharges between outings.

  7. Warranty and Support:
    A solid warranty and good customer support are essential. Manufacturers typically offer warranties ranging from 2 to 10 years. A long warranty indicates the manufacturer’s confidence in their product and assures users they can get help if issues arise.

  8. Temperature Range:
    The operational temperature range informs users about the environmental viability of the battery. Many LiFePO4 batteries function efficiently within a range from -20°C to 60°C (-4°F to 140°F). Knowing this helps ensure battery reliability under different weather conditions while fishing.

  9. Compatibility with Trolling Motor Models:
    Compatibility ensures that the battery can function effectively with your specific trolling motor. Check the manufacturer’s specifications for compatibility, as some batteries are designed exclusively for certain brands or models, which affects performance and effectiveness.

How Long Can You Expect a 36V LiFePO4 Battery to Last, and What Maintenance Is Required?

A 36V LiFePO4 battery can last between 2,000 and 3,000 charge cycles before reaching about 80% of its original capacity. This translates to approximately 5 to 10 years of use, depending on usage patterns and maintenance practices. In typical applications, such as electric bicycles or solar energy systems, this lifespan can vary based on factors like depth of discharge and charging habits.

Depth of discharge, or how much of the battery’s capacity is used before recharging, significantly affects longevity. For example, consistently discharging the battery to 50% instead of 20% can extend its life. Additionally, charging at a moderate rate and avoiding complete discharges can prevent damage and enhance performance.

Maintenance for a 36V LiFePO4 battery includes regular monitoring of its state of charge and conducting periodic checks for balance among individual cells. Keeping the battery clean and ensuring proper ventilation are also essential. Avoiding exposure to extreme temperatures can prevent thermal damage.

Ambient temperature plays a role in battery life. For instance, using the battery in temperatures exceeding 60°C (140°F) can decrease its lifespan. Storage conditions matter too; a fully charged battery stored at 25°C (77°F) will maintain better health than one stored at high temperatures.

For example, if you use a 36V LiFePO4 battery in an electric bike, riding frequently while ensuring that you recharge it after moderate use will lead to better durability compared to letting the battery deplete fully after each ride, especially in hot weather.

Consideration should be given to battery quality, as variations in manufacturing can lead to differences in performance. Some brands may use higher-grade materials, resulting in better longevity and safety.

Overall, a combination of mindful usage, regular maintenance, and proper storage can maximize the life of a 36V LiFePO4 battery.

  2. Avoid Overcharging the Battery:
    Avoiding overcharging the battery is crucial for safety. Overcharging can lead to overheating and potential battery failure or explosion. Most LiFePO4 batteries come with built-in protection systems to prevent overcharging. However, users should always monitor the charging process and use compatible chargers, as advised by manufacturers.

  8. Use Appropriate Connectors and Fuses:
    Using appropriate connectors and fuses enhances safety during battery operation. Compatible connectors ensure secure connections, reducing the risk of arcing or short circuits. Fuses protect batteries from overloads by breaking the circuit before damage occurs.
